Specs:
  • Apple M3 8-Core/16-Core Neural Engine Chip Processor
  • 15.3" 2560x1664 Liquid Retina Display
  • FaceTime Full HD Camera
  • 512GB Solid State Drive
  • 24GB Unified RAM
  • 10-Core GPU
  • Wi-Fi 6E (802.11ax) w/ Bluetooth 5.3
  • Backlit Magic Keyboard
  • Force Touch Trackpad/Touch ID Sensor
  • 2x Thunderbolt / USB4
  • macOS
